Transaction 41d24bcb79ca84e230f6e4e189e8eb783d5d3ec4f9d73e698e9fe56018bfc636

1 Input
2 Outputs
  • 41d24bcb79ca84e230f6e4e189e8eb783d5d3ec4f9d73e698e9fe56018bfc636:0
  • value  6243341
    address  3G8J4EdWB7kg3Y7XoeoL21snhr93JhsgPg
  • 41d24bcb79ca84e230f6e4e189e8eb783d5d3ec4f9d73e698e9fe56018bfc636:1
  • value  438096815
    address  1PqGHYAQH9S4AcTiCsaZxeCHoKPUipND2g